Output 24fe09a3c38e3fc75be2d20869d9576247495b89141e84362118fe87b9254a30:0

value
539026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c318428ecf85b6de2a8c553a649dcdb169fac4eb OP_EQUAL
address
3KUakZh5QbDAptEt8aZaHXrZacaty41P69
transaction
24fe09a3c38e3fc75be2d20869d9576247495b89141e84362118fe87b9254a30
spent
true